1.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the definition of 'falling action' in a story?

Back

The falling action refers to the events that lead to the resolution of the story.

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What does 'setting' refer to in a narrative?

Back

Setting refers to when and where the story takes place.

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

Identify the story element described: 'The snow melted off the pine trees and a puddle formed in the shadows of the trees.'

Back

This passage describes the setting.

4.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the purpose of the 'resolution' in a story?

Back

The resolution is the part of the story where the problems are solved, typically found at the end.

5.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What are the main components of a story's plot structure?

Back

The main components include exposition, rising action, climax, falling action, and resolution.

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

How does the 'rising action' contribute to a story?

Back

The rising action builds tension and develops the conflict leading up to the climax.

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the climax of a story?

Back

The climax is the turning point or the most intense moment in the story, where the main conflict reaches its peak.
